Be part of a weeklong BioBlitz at Voyageurs National Park and help document the incredible diversity of life found throughout the park. Using iNaturalist, visitors, volunteers, and staff will explore trails, shorelines, and visitor areas to record observations of plants, animals, fungi, and more.
